Scientific Purpose/Goals: Investigation of earthquake induced submarine landslide deposits following 2018 M7.1 Anchorage event
Vehicle(s): None
Start Port/Location: Anchorage, AK
End Port/Location: Anchorage, AK
Start Date: 2020-08-27
End Date: 2020-09-16
Equipment Used: navigation equipment, core, 0.5-16 kHz, 0.5-16 kHz receiver, Mini sparker, multichannel
Information to be Derived: Chirp .5-16; minisparker MCS (24 ch), with spares
Summary of Activity and Data Gathered: Operations during field activity 2020-615-FA successfully collected a geophysical (MCS+Chirp) and geologic (sediment cores) dataset.
